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Residential property management refers to the supervision and maintenance of residential properties on behalf of property owners. This includes managing rental properties, ensuring that they are well-maintained, handling tenant issues, and maximizing the property's profitability. Residential property management is a profession that requires knowledge of various areas such as property maintenance, tenant relationships, legal regulations, financial management, and marketing. The importance of residential property management cannot be overstated. It plays a crucial role in ensuring that both property owners and tenants have a positive and mutually beneficial experience. For property owners, hiring a professional property manager can alleviate the stress and responsibilities that come with owning rental properties. Property managers take care of all the day-to-day operations, from advertising vacancies and screening tenants to collecting rent and coordinating repairs. This allows owners to focus on other aspects of their lives or invest in additional properties. On the other hand, tenants benefit from having a property manager who is responsible for the upkeep of the property. A good property manager ensures that maintenance issues are addressed promptly, common areas are well-maintained, and that tenant concerns are dealt with in a timely manner. They also provide a point of contact for any emergencies or urgent situations that may arise.
